WebThe staged combustion cycle is an engine cycle where the propellants are burned in several stages (pre-burner and main combustion), improving fuel efficiency. Indeed, this closed cycle improves the fuel efficiency compared to an open cycle like gas generator where the gas driving the pump is exhausted overboard. WebA rocket engine cycle refers to the way in which the liquid propellants are transported from the tanks to the combustion chamber. Web18 Apr 2024 · The gas generator cycle is widely used on rocket engines, but some variations are still possible and desireable. For instance, the Falcon launcher burns the derived flux with much kerosene and little oxygen to limit the turbine's temperature, but the resulting soot complicates the reuse of the engine. Web13 Mar 2024 · Usually, there are three types of engine cycles that determine the configuration of the turbopump in liquid rocket engines: the staged combustion cycle, the expander cycle, and the gas generator cycle. Here, the engine cycle means the source of energy required to drive its turbine. filcon germanyWebThe type of engine cycle selected also influences the turbopump requirements and configuration. Generally, three types of engine cycles have been used in liquid rocket engines: the gas generator cycle, the staged combustion cycle and the expander cycle.
